Файл: Федеральное государственное бюджетное образовательное учреждение высшего образования тюменский индустриальный.docx
Добавлен: 09.12.2023
Просмотров: 96
Скачиваний: 1
ВНИМАНИЕ! Если данный файл нарушает Ваши авторские права, то обязательно сообщите нам.
МИНИСТЕРСТВО НАУКИ И ВЫСШЕГО ОБРАЗОВАНИЯ Российской Федерации
ФЕДЕРАЛЬНОЕ ГОСУДАРСТВЕННОЕ БЮДЖЕТНОЕ
ОБРАЗОВАТЕЛЬНОЕ УЧРЕЖДЕНИЕ ВЫСШЕГО ОБРАЗОВАНИЯ
«ТЮМЕНСКИЙ ИНДУСТРИАЛЬНЫЙ университет»
МНОГОПРОФИЛЬНЫЙ КОЛЛЕДЖ
ОТЧЕТ
ОБ УЧЕБНОЙ ПРАКТИКЕ
(указать вид практики)
в Многопрофильном колледже ФГБОУ ВО ТИУ
(наименование организации/предприятия)
Обучающегося Шиндина Дениса Николаевича
Курса 3
Группы ПКСт-20-(9)-1
Специальности (профессии) 09.02.03 Программирование в компьютерных системах
(код) (наименование специальности/профессии)
В период с « 20 » апреля по « 03 » мая 20 23 г.
В качестве практиканта
РУКОВОДИТЕЛЬ:
ОТ УНИВЕРСИТЕТА Сергиенко Евгения Викторовна, преподаватель отделения СОНХ
Тюмень
2023
Содержание
Введение 5
1.1Анализ предметной области 7
1.2Необходимый набор сущностей 8
1.3Связи между сущностями и структура связей 9
1.4Построение концептуальной модели данных 12
2.1Переход от ERD к предварительным отношениям 14
2.2Построение логической модели данных 17
3.1Построение отношений с учетом СУБД 19
3.2Запросы на создание таблиц 21
3.3Построение физической модели данных 24
Заключение 30
Список использованных источников 32
ДНЕВНИК
УЧЕБНОЙ ПРАКТИКИ
Обучающегося | Шиндина Дениса Николаевича | ||||
(фамилия, имя, отчество) | |||||
Курс | 3 | группа | ПКСт-20-(9)-1 | ||
| | | (наименование группы) | ||
По специальности/профессии | 09.02.03 | ||||
(наименование специальности/профессии) | |||||
Программирование в компьютерных системах | |||||
| |||||
Многопрофильный колледж ФГБОУ ВО ТИУ | |||||
(наименование организации/предприятия, на котором проходит практика) | |||||
Сергиенко Евгения Викторовна, преподаватель отделения СОНХ | |||||
(ФИО, должность руководителя практики от учебного заведения) |
Дата | Наименование работ | Объем часов | Оценка | Подпись руководителя |
20.04.2023 | Инструктаж по техники безопасности. Организация рабочего места. Разработка и проектирование локальных вычислительных сетей | 6 | | |
21.04.2023 | Установка Windows server 2012 | 6 | | |
22.04.2023 | Настройка файлового сервера | 6 | | |
24.04.2023 | Настройка DNS сервера | 6 | | |
25.04.2023 | Настройка DHCP сервера | 6 | | |
26.04.2023 | Создание пользователей и групп в Active Directory | 6 | | |
27.04.2023 | Проектирование структуры БД методом «Сущность-связь». Использование Case-средства для получения кода для генерации кода | 6 | | |
28.04.2023 | Использование Case-средства для получения кода для генерации кода. Реализация базы данных в СУБД MS Access, MS SQL Server | 8 | | |
29.04.2023 | Реализация базы данных в СУБД MS SQL Server, Создание форм, отчетов | 6 | | |
02.05.2023 | Реализация клиентского приложения в Visual Studio для БД, созданной в СУБД MS Access, СУБД MS SQL Server | 8 | | |
03.05.2023 | Реализация клиентского приложения в Visual Studio для БД, созданной в СУБД MS SQL Server. Оформление отчета в соответствии с требованиями | 6 | | |
03.05.2023 | Дифференцированный зачет | 2 | | |
Всего за период практики с «20» апреля 2023г. по «03» апреля 2023г.
отработано 72 часа.
Руководитель практики: / Е.В.Сергиенко
(подпись, расшифровка подписи)
Введение
Целью данной практики является комплексное освоение видов деятельности. Для выполнения цели данной практики будет разработана база данных «Зоопарк» с учётом всех элементов и связей.
Для разработки базы данных были выделены следующие задачи:
1) анализ предметной области;
2) подбор сущностей;
3) построение связи между сущностями ;
4) построение концептуальной модели данных;
5) построение логической модели данных;
6) построение отношений с учётом СУБД;
7) создание таблиц и их связей в СУБД;
8) построение физической модели данных.
Учебная практика проходила в Многопрофильном колледже ФГБОУ ВО ТИУ. Было предоставлено лабораторное оборудование на месте прохождения практики:
-
системный блок (Процессор: Intel Core i3-8100; ОЗУ: 8 ГБ; HDD 2 ТБ); -
мышь, клавиатура и монитор.
На компьютерах предприятия присутствовала программное обеспечение:
-
менеджер баз данных DBeaver; -
менеджер серверов Microsoft SQL Server Management Studio 18; -
построитель логических схем Case Studio 2; -
рабочие сервера MS SQL и PostgreSQL; -
набор Office 2007; -
браузер Chrome и Firefox;
Во многих городах присутствуют зоопарки, где большое количество видов животных из разных стран, каждый такой вид должен иметь специализированный вольер, разный рацион. Для соблюдения всех правил по комфортному содержанию животных будет разработана база данных с учётом разных видов животных в зоопарке, их вольеров, рациона каждого из видов и их состояния.
Для выполнения данной работы из открытых источников были взяты сведения о зоопарках разных городов, о том, как они устроены, а также информация о разных видовых особенностях в рационе животных и их место обитания. На основе этой информации и была разработана база данных.
-
Проектирование концептуальной модели данных
-
Анализ предметной области
-
Зоопарки во многих городах являются большой по площади территорией, где обитают всевозможные виды животных
, многие из которых требуют особого ухода. Работникам порой бывает сложно уследить за всем, он может не покормить или не напоить животное которое в этом нуждалось, что может привести к ухудшению здоровью животного или же к агрессии. Для упрощения работы и будет разработана база данных, где будет присутствовать информация о вольерах животных, их состоянии, площадь, его параметры и наполнение, информация о животных включает описание вида, пола, состояние здоровья, семейства и ореола обитания, их предпочтения в еде. Так же будет присутствовать система расписаний для работников, где будет записываться действия, которое следует выполнить, временной промежуток, отведённый на его выполнение и количество затраченного времени.
В базе данных будут пользователи трёх ролей: работник и администратор, руководитель отдела зоопарка.
Администратор обслуживает базу данных. Он имеет возможности полностью изменять базу данных.
В базе данных руководители отделов зоопарка получают свои логины и пароль, зайдя в систему предприятия, он может редактировать информацию о вольерах и животных находящихся на территории его отдела, формировать расписание для работников, какие вольеры следует почистить того или иного обитателя вольера, когда следует напоить или покормить.
В базе данных работник одного из отделов получает свой логин и пароль, зайдя в систему предприятия, он может просматривать информацию о принадлежности к одному из отделов, просматривать и редактировать информацию о его расписании и вольерах, к которым он будет приставлен.
Использование базы данных на предприятие приведёт:
-
к упрощению формирования отчётов и отслеживанию каждого из животных; -
к повышению эффективности сотрудника за счёт расписанного графика; -
к уменьшению риска ухудшить состояние здоровья животного, за счёт своевременной уборки вольера и его кормёжки.
-
Необходимый набор сущностей
В ходе проектирования базы данных были выделены следующие сущности и атрибуты:
-
пользователь: код пользователя, логин, пароль; -
категория пользователя: код категории, название категории; -
вольер: код вольера, площадь, параметры, наполнение; -
вид: код вида, название вида; -
пол: код пола, название пола; -
класс животного: код класса, название класса; -
ореол обитания: код ореола, название ореола -
животное: код животного, состояние здоровья, предпочтение в еде. -
отдел зоопарка: код отдела, название отдела; -
расписание работника: код расписания, дата начала, дата окончания, что сделать.